Thomas Named to America East All-Rookie Team
5/1/2025 12:10:00 PM | Women's Lacrosse
BOSTON – Freshman goalkeeper Ellie Thomas (Needham, Mass.) of the University of New Hampshire women's lacrosse team was named to the America East All-Rookie Team on Thursday.
Thomas, who was a two-time conference Goalkeeper of the Week (Feb. 10 and March 3) and Rookie of the Week (March 10) honoree during the 2025 season, is No. 8 in the nation in saves per game (10.87) and 14th in saves (163). She is the America East leader in both those stats and ranks fourth in save percentage (.409) as well as sixth in ground balls per game (1.93).
Thomas started all 15 games and played all 888 minutes. She recorded 10+ saves in 11 of 15 games with a high of 16 against both Merrimack College and Cornell University. Thomas made 11 saves to backstop the Wildcats to a 15-5 victory against Marist College in the Feb. 8 season opener.
Thomas finished the season atop the UNH leaderboard in ground balls with 29. She recorded a ground ball in 14 of 15 games. Thomas recorded multiple ground balls in seven games with a high of five GBs against both UMBC and the University of Vermont.
